[email protected] Julie Van Sicklehttps://natmus.humboldt.edu/events/earth-science-week-after-school-programCelebrate Earth Science Week with the HSU Natural History Museum (NHM) through a live virtual after school program 4:00 p.m.to 5:15 p.m. daily Monday Oct. 11th - Friday Oct. 16th. These 75 mins. sessions are geared towards children 8-12 years old. Pre-registration is required so we can send a packet of activities and materials.Each day has a theme:Mon. 10/11 - The Incredible Sun. Learn about Earth's engine - the sun - and the incredible energy it generates. Make a visible light spectrum, a string of UV activated beads, and how our star fits into the suite of star types within our galaxy.Tues. 10/12 - Stars and Galaxies. Take a journey through our universe and understand some of the techniques used to study far away objects. During this session you will identify galaxies in a Hubble space telescope image and be introduced to quasars, black holes, red giants, and how to time travel.Wed. 10/13 - Forces of Water. Water has a greater force than you may think and continues to shape our planet. Learn about some of the geographic features that allow us to study the age of the Earth and how to model a watershed along with learning about the properties of water.Thurs. 10/14 - Remarkable Rocks. Do you like rocks? Do you have a favorite rock? This is the time to learn about rocks, get rocks you have at home identified, how they are formed, and learn how rocks can tell an incredible story about the fourth dimension - time.Fri. 10/15 - Fossil Clues. Sequence a series of events that leads to finding a fossil.
